Back by popular demand “The Rolling Emotions” take the stage for The Rock of Aging Revival. A hit band in the 60’s and 70’s, Ricki D. Bones, Willie Withers, and Tina Tumor are struggling to “keep on keepin’ on.” Poor financial management and the rigors of aging have forced them to sing for their supper by taking any gigs they can, like recording jingles for commercials for seniors’ products. Now, along with their new back-up singers, the band has a chance for a big comeback, as part of the AARP National “Feeling Groovy” Tour. The group finds new life as they give the songs of their youth fresh meaning—singing about the maladies of getting older, such as weight gain, memory loss, and gastric distress (think about having that first colonoscopy performed to the chorus, “Snake it Up Doctor, if you twist I’ll shout!”). Join with the band as they admit that while aging “ain’t for sissies,” it’s much easier to face with the help of their beloved rock and roll.
